TROUBLESHOOTING

RADIO ELECTRICS + REEL REWIND

The reel rewind speed is too slow

Engine revs. too low.
Remedy – Increase engine revs to ¾ revs or 2400 RPM.

Drive belts slipping
Remedy – Adjust belts with the belt tensioner

The reel is hard to pull out

Reel brake is adjusted too tight
Remedy – Adjust brake

The reel does not retract and the manual button DOES work
  1. Digital code not synchronised.
    Remedy – 12 dip switches in transmitter must correspond with switches in radio receiver board.
  2. Discharged transmitter battery.
    Remedy – Replace 9 volt battery.
  3. Wrong transmitter (9TBE only).
    Remedy – R=right 27.195 MHz, L=left 27.145 MHz.
  4. Faulty receiver or transmitter.
    Remedy – Call factory for radio return authorisation form. 1800-645-688 .
The reel only retracts at a close distance
  1. Discharged transmitter battery.
    Remedy – Replace (216-9V).
  2. Aerial broken or loose on base.
    Remedy – Replace or tighten aerial. Finger tight only! If more than finger tight the coax cable will break inside the aerial base..
  3. Coax broken inside of aerial base.
    Remedy – Replace the aerial base and coax cable.
  4. Low 12V. on machine.
    Remedy – Charge or replace battery. 12.5 voltage output allows optimum performance.
  5. Faulty receiver or transmitter.
    Remedy – Call factory for radio return authorisation form. 1800-645-688.
  6. Interference from overhead power lines or other.
    Remedy – Relocate the spraying system.

IMPORTANT NOTE.

Transmitters on “9TBE” & “9TDE” Twin reel units have two different built in frequencies. 27.145 MHz for the left side reel & 27.195MHz for the right reel. Therefore, you cannot re-code the digital dip switch on one side to work the other side.

PUMPS + PRESSURE CONTROLLERS

My pump will not deliver pressure and there is good flow from the By-Pass back to the tank
  1. Regulating valve not set for pressure
    Remedy – set lever (8) to “press” and adjust knob (6)
  2. Damaged or worn seat or spring in regulator
    Remedy – replace with Sting repair kit or new spring
  3. Sticking pressure regulator slide
    Remedy – remove slide & lubricate with marine grease
  4. Spray nozzle/s worn, missing, or exceed pump capacity
    Remedy – replace Spray Nozzles with appropriate size
My pump will not deliver pressure and there is IRREGULAR flow from the By-Pass to tank
  1. One or more valves are not seating.
    Remedy – clean or replace valves.
  2. Sucking air through suction line or filter.
    Remedy – examine and repair.
  3. Air has not been entirely evacuated from pump.
    Remedy – run pump with lever (8) on by-pass until all air is evacuated.
  4. Blocked suction filter or valve closed.
    Remedy – clean filter or open ball valve.
  5. Motor to Pump drive belts loose /broken or Direct coupling damaged
    Remedy – tension belts or replace, replace direct coupling sprockets and chain
  6. Reputed spray hoses or fittings.
    Remedy – repair or replace.
My pump is delivering insufficient pressure and the hoses are jumping
  1. One or more valves are not seating.
    Remedy – clean or replace valves.

  2. Diaphragm split (Oil will go milky)
    Remedy – STOP PUMP! Replace (see pump manual)

  3. Air has not been entirely evacuated from pump.
    Remedy – run pump with lever (8) on by-pass, until air is evacuated

  4. Sucking air through suction line or filter.
    Remedy – examine and repair

  5. Oil level is low.
    Remedy – top up with 20W/30

My pump is delivering insufficient pressure and the hoses are NOT jumping
  1. Damaged or worn seat or spring in regulator.
    Remedy – replace.

  2. Sticking regulator slide
    Remedy – remove slide & lubricate with marine grease

  3. Spray nozzles worn, missing, or exceed the pump capacity
    Remedy – replace nozzles with appropriate size.

  4. Main drive belts slipping.
    Remedy – tension belts or replace, replace direct coupling sprockets and chain.

  5. Leaking hoses or fittings.
    Remedy – repair or replace

My pump is noisy
  1. Oil level is low.
    Remedy – top up with 20W/30
  2. Sucking air or air in pump.
    Remedy – examine and repair.
  3. Blocked filter.
    Remedy – clean filter.
The oil has changed colour to white / There is oil in the spray hose

One or more diaphragms are split.
Remedy – STOP PUMP IMMEDIATELY & replace diaphragms

Water is returning to tank through safety valve hose

Worn safety valve (Pressure adjusted to high.)
Remedy – replace safety valve.

What oil do I use for the pump?

The pump oil you need is SAE 30. You can purchase this from any auto parts store.

I have water in my oil glass

If you have water in the oil glass on the pump, you have ruptured your pump diaphragms and they will need to be replaced.  If you continue to run your unit with ruptured diaphragms it will seize the pump and at that point, the pump will need to be replaced. Can I run diesel through my Quik Spray?

No, you can’t. You need to make sure the chemicals you are using are compatible with the diaphragms in your pump and pressure controller.  If not, you will need to upgrade to Desmopan or Viton diaphragms to help with wear and tear.
